Biogen's Aduhelm (Aducanumab) is approved under accelerated approval by the FDA for patients with Alzheimer's Disease. This shatters the bear narrative surrounding Biogen and signals a bullish turn for other CNS companies. However, the FDA is in a difficult spot given they will be forced to make more decisions about CNS assets that show no clinical efficacy, but have an impact on biomarkers.
